Seize the chance to own a piece of history in the heart of Omemee, the gateway to the beauty of Kawartha Lakes 15-minute drive from Peterborough. This iconic former church building offers an expansive and versatile footprint, perfectly suited for organizations looking to make a lasting impact in a community that values heritage and creativity. Positioned on a substantial lot with a very large backyard, this property provides rare outdoor space that is perfect for a playground, community garden, or future expansion. The building itself is a powerhouse of functional space: the main level features a grand sanctuary with vaulted ceilings and excellent acoustics. The large, fully finished lower level offers a high-capacity hall, complete with a full kitchen, ready for community dinners, caterings, or daily meal prep for a busy educational center. Community Facility (CF) Zoning permits a flexible variety of uses: Educational & Childcare: Ideal for Day Nurseries, Elementary, or Secondary Schools. Culture & Gathering: A natural fit for Places of Worship, Community Centers and Clubs, Libraries, Museums, or Arenas. Health & Wellness: Medical Centers are allowed.
